How to say I have
Use tá and agam for possession. Occasionally, tá and orm
Tá súile gorma agam I have blue eyes, literally "(There) are tá blue eyes at me agam"
Tá gruaig fhionn orm I have fair hair, literally "There is tá fair hair on me orm.

Just as dom above has seven forms to express the persons so also have agam and orm.
These words are actually a combination of the prepositions do to, for; ag at and ar on with the personal pronouns mé, tú, sé, sí, sinn, sibh, siad most of which you have met above with tá.
The following tables show the forms for each of these. You should learn them by heart.

| mé tú sé sí sinn sibh siad |
I You he/it she/it we you (pl) They |
agam agat aige aici againn agaibh acu |
at me at you at him/at it (masc) at her/at it (fem) at us at you at them |
orm ort air uirthi orainn oraibh orthu |
on me on you on him/it (masc) on her/it (fem) on us on you (pl) on them |
